The Source Code (Summary)

OpenClaw's AI skill hub, which has been the talk of the town, is now under scrutiny for its lax security. Researchers have discovered malware lurking in numerous user-submitted "skill" extensions, making the platform a prime target for cyber mischief. According to 1Password's VP Jason Meller, the hub has become an "attack surface," with even the most popular add-ons potentially harboring harmful payloads.
